How to Freeze Garlic Cloves
Wondering if you can freeze whole garlic cloves? Here’s how I freeze garlic cloves.

Instructions
Peel the garlic. Make sure to cut off the tough root end.
Place the garlic in a single layer on a lined sheet pan. A little overlap is fine but avoid creating a pile on the sheet pan.
Flash freeze the garlic cloves (covered or uncovered) for 2 to 3 hours, or until frozen. This depends on how cold you set your freezer.
Transfer the frozen garlic cloves into a
freezer-safe airtight container
or
bag
. You can also
vacuum seal
them as well.
Freeze for up to 6 months.
